Transaction 7671070eab199d5c9e70364da8ae94331742d09b3fd15057f94dde065fdf7dbe

1 Input
2 Outputs
  • 7671070eab199d5c9e70364da8ae94331742d09b3fd15057f94dde065fdf7dbe:0
  • value  148598
    address  15iWNMDVRsPyuU5FfxdKH368bMnEEwazPo
  • 7671070eab199d5c9e70364da8ae94331742d09b3fd15057f94dde065fdf7dbe:1
  • value  2987958880
    address  1exRGehhY7A1hEYT7ThBbb59BoLvBcx1C